Garden to Table Chiangmai
Owner makes all sauces from scratch gluten-free, and staff are described as knowledgeable about coeliac needs. Several reviewers report a dedicated gluten-free fryer, but one reports no dedicated fryer, and the venue is not a dedicated gluten-free facility. Menus are inconsistently reported as GF-marked. Cross-contamination risk exists in the shared kitchen.

Honest caveat: Multiple reviewer reports conflict on whether a dedicated gluten-free fryer is available, which reduces confidence for coeliac-safe dining.

Vegan
confidence 65% ·
Reliable, Allergen-marked menu with aware staff, served from a shared kitchen. Cross-contamination risk is acknowledged but the venue has clear options.
Venue offers many vegan options and staff will swap egg noodles for potato noodles to make dishes vegan. The HappyCow listing tags the venue as having 'many amazing vegan options' with separate cooking. The kitchen is shared with meat dishes, so cross-contact with animal ingredients is possible.

Vegetarian
confidence 65% ·
Reliable, Allergen-marked menu with aware staff, served from a shared kitchen. Cross-contamination risk is acknowledged but the venue has clear options.
The venue is described as welcoming for vegetarian diets alongside gluten-free and vegan options. Staff accommodate substitutions such as swapping noodles, and the shared kitchen prepares both meat and non-meat dishes. Cross-contact risk present.
